New Graphic Novel from Pegamoose Press, Orchard of the Tame!

Orchard of the Tame is an exciting debut graphic novel by Marlo Meekins and Nick Cross that introduces us to a fantastical world reminiscent of classic fairy tales, matching whimsical heroes against sinister villains. 🌈

This beautiful coming-of-age/dark fantasy is an absolute feast of imagination as we follow River Siren, a young mermaid navigating the beauty and horror of the world outside of her prison, on her journey towards self-actualization.🧜‍♀️

With help from her newfound friends, she must overcome her fears and confront the monster who kept her caged. 🌟

Inspired by comics and animation such as Jeff Smith's Bone, Nick Cross's characters exude life and emotion as their world and environments draw you in with their richness and beauty.🎭

Fans of Cartoon Network's Over the Garden Wall will feel instantly drawn to the art as Nick Cross was the art director for the series and won two Emmy awards for his work on the show. 🏆💫

"Eye opening, frightful and full of life, Orchard of the Tame by Meekins & Cross is teeming with the DNA of fairy tales and thousands of cartoons, and yet it feels elementary and new. Not only that, but the drawings of trees alone is worth the price of admission. We love blue!"

~ Jeff Smith, Creator of BONE, RASL, TUKI and THORN

"Orchard of the Tame is a wonderfully strange, personal, funny, dark, moving fairytale created by two of my favorite people in the world, brilliantly realized in gorgeous black & white. Ainsprid is one of the weirdest, creepiest villains ever.”

~Patrick McHale, Over the Garden Wall
